Kegani Racing Academy has unveiled thrilling plans for its third season of the SKILLDRVN One Make Race Series and announced the launch of the all-new SKILLDRVN SWIFT SUPERCUP PRO-SERIES, set to debut in 2026.
The SKILLDRVN One Make Race Series returns for its third season with five action-packed rounds scheduled as part of the Malaysia Speed Festival (MSF) at the Petronas Sepang International Circuit. Designed to foster emerging talent, the series features identical Suzuki Swift race cars with minimal modifications, ensuring a level playing field.
Equipped with a production 1.6-liter engine and a 5-speed manual transmission, the cars also feature a 12-point roll cage, FIA-approved racing seats and harnesses, series-spec suspension, and race-ready components like steel braided brake lines and alloy wheels. Drivers can either purchase the car outright or opt for the Academy’s convenient arrive-and-drive rental program.
Since its debut in 2023, the SKILLDRVN One Make Race Series has established itself as a grassroots platform offering classroom and track training to help aspiring racers accelerate their learning curves while keeping costs manageable.
“The one-make format helps aspiring racers focus on skill development while making motorsports more accessible,” said Kenny Lee, Team Principal and Chief Coach of Kegani Racing Academy. “Heading into Season 3, we’re seeing a surge of interest from new talent, which is really exciting for the future of Malaysian motorsports.”
The 2024 season concluded with lady driver Loke Yin Yi crowned as the overall champion, earning RM8,500 worth of products and racing incentives. Notably, 15-year-old rookie Kirill Syrapushchynski emerged as a rising star, finishing runner-up in his debut season after transitioning from karting.
Looking ahead, Kegani Racing Academy is set to introduce the SKILLDRVN SWIFT SUPERCUP PRO-SERIES in 2026. This professional-level competition will feature 10 teams, each selecting one driver from the talent pool of the SKILLDRVN One Make Race Series.
Drivers selected for the Pro-Series will receive race contracts covering all expenses, while teams will showcase full car liveries for branding and sponsorship opportunities. Two teams, BENDIX ULTIMATE RACING TEAM and Team PROFIMAX MAX UP, have already confirmed their participation.
“The Pro-Series offers a pathway for talented drivers to advance into professional racing with full team support, providing them with the resources and exposure needed to excel,” Lee explained.
